Su Cheng is the longest serving Incense Master of the Yellow Lotus. Even though he has been with the lodge since its inception very little is known about him. There are plenty of rumors like the fact he may be a vampire, that he found the perfect combination of Taoist and Hermetic magical theory, or that he has reached enlightenment.

